Output 17e645c776e7ba40d95a61c87e640384b6e16d3a6db9f8362cb7e4eff0386dba:1

value
2693049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eadc4a00f5cc6edeee6b78aae2e462eb9aaaf943 OP_EQUAL
address
3P6qwPK2BGCNCWnf1nPVrjeRrmQQ65PeqE
transaction
17e645c776e7ba40d95a61c87e640384b6e16d3a6db9f8362cb7e4eff0386dba
spent
true